NORMAN BLUE

Source: Crawfordsville Journal Review 6 Feb 1957 p 4 typed by Walt W

Norman Blue, 76, a retired farmer and former resident of Montgomery County, died Tuesday night in his home, 929 Wacker Dr., Danville, Ill. He had been in failing health one year and seriously ill three weeks. Born April 2, 1880, near Covington, Mr. Blue was the son of Ezekiel and Anna Cronk Blue. He married Jessie Griffith Aug. 25, 1925, at Williamsport. He was a member of the Salem Methodist Church near Covington. Survivors include a daughter, Mrs. Rebecca Bryant of Danville, Ill.; a brother, J. C. Blue of Elwood; two sisters, Mrs. Elizabeth Fisher of Elwood and Mrs. Wallace Epperson of Hillsboro, and two grandchildren. The wife, a brother and four half-brothers preceded him in death. Funeral services will be at 2 p.m. Friday at the Proffitt & Brown Funeral Home. Rev. Eddie Bamish of New Ross will be the officiating minister. Burial will be in the Greenlawn Cemetery at Darlington. Friends may call at the funeral home. Funeral services for Norman Blue, who died Tuesday at his home in Danville, Ill., were conducted at the Proffitt and Brown Funeral Home Friday at 2 p. m. with Rev. Eddie Bamish officiating. Burial was in Greenlawn Cemetery at Darlington. Pallbearers, who also assisted with flowers, were Robert Lang, Fred Carroll, Elsworth Glaze, Ralph Taylor, Carl Epperson and Harry Epperson. Organist was Mrs. Nellie Shepherd.
